Top Chateau Madrid Restaurant | Reviews & Ratings | comparemela.com

Chateau madrid restaurant in United states - 33174/ near miami-dade

Chateau madrid restaurant in United states - 95376/ near san-joaquin

Chateau madrid restaurant in Puerto rico - 33174/ near miami-dade

Chateau madrid restaurant in United states - 07008/ near carteret